THE 39 STEPS, written by Patrick Barlow, is an outlandish spoof of the old Alfred Hitchcock movie. Our hero meets a mysterious woman who tells him she’s in danger and later turns up dead. Soon, he is pursued across England by the police and a mysterious spy organization.
Four actors play over 140 characters in this fast-paced comedy loaded with Alfred Hitchcock film references. The cast includes: Mike Krcil as the hero, Mary Young as the three women with whom he has entanglements, and Johnny Molson and Travis Wiggins play everyone else: heroes, villains, women, children and the occasional inanimate object. The show will be directed by Rich McCoy.
